/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/sixdof/Renderer/ |
D | BaseRenderer.java | 21 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 24 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.MATRIX_4X4; 25 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.ORIENTATION_360_ANTI_CLOCKWI… 26 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 27 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 28 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z; 140 case MathsUtils.ORIENTATION_0: in onSurfaceChanged() 141 case MathsUtils.ORIENTATION_180_ANTI_CLOCKWISE: in onSurfaceChanged() 142 case MathsUtils.ORIENTATION_360_ANTI_CLOCKWISE: in onSurfaceChanged() 144 case MathsUtils.ORIENTATION_90_ANTI_CLOCKWISE: in onSurfaceChanged() [all …]
|
D | ComplexMovementRenderer.java | 24 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 29 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.MATRIX_4X4; 85 MathsUtils.convertToOpenGlCoordinates(ring.getLocation(), mOpenGlRotation); in onSurfaceCreated() 87 MathsUtils.convertToOpenGlCoordinates(ring.getRingRotation(), mOpenGlRotation); in onSurfaceCreated() 125 mLight.updateLightPosition(MathsUtils.convertToOpenGlCoordinates( in doTestSpecificRendering()
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/sixdof/Renderer/RenderUtils/ |
D | ConeModelMatrixCalculator.java | 19 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 21 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 22 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 23 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z; 39 … float[] convertedTranslation = MathsUtils.convertToOpenGlCoordinates(translation, mToRotate); in updateModelMatrix() 44 float[] translationMatrix = new float[MathsUtils.MATRIX_4X4]; in updateModelMatrix() 49 … float[] openGlRingPosition = MathsUtils.convertToOpenGlCoordinates(lookAtPosition, mToRotate); in updateModelMatrix() 50 float[] rotationTransformation = new float[MathsUtils.MATRIX_4X4]; in updateModelMatrix() 52 float[] relativeVector = new float[MathsUtils.VECTOR_3D]; in updateModelMatrix() 59 MathsUtils.setLookAtM(rotationTransformation, in updateModelMatrix()
|
D | ModelMatrixCalculator.java | 18 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.MATRIX_4X4; 19 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 20 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 21 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z; 25 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 97 quaternionMatrix = MathsUtils.quaternionMatrixOpenGL(quaternion); in calculateModelMatrix() 109 MathsUtils.getDeviceOrientationMatrix(mToRotate), 0); in calculateModelMatrix() 126 … float[] convertedTranslation = MathsUtils.convertToOpenGlCoordinates(translation, mToRotate); in updateModelMatrix() 131 mDevice2IMUMatrix = MathsUtils.quaternionMatrixOpenGL(quaternion); in setDevice2IMUMatrix() 141 mColorCamera2IMUMatrix = MathsUtils.quaternionMatrixOpenGL(quaternion); in setColorCamera2IMUMatrix()
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/sixdof/Renderer/Renderable/ |
D | Renderable.java | 19 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 21 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 22 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 23 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z; 43 private float[] mModelMatrix = new float[MathsUtils.MATRIX_4X4]; 44 private float[] mMvMatrix = new float[MathsUtils.MATRIX_4X4]; 45 private float[] mMvpMatrix = new float[MathsUtils.MATRIX_4X4];
|
D | RingRenderable.java | 22 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 24 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 25 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 26 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z; 55 float[] overallTransformation = new float[MathsUtils.MATRIX_4X4]; in RingRenderable() 59 float[] rotationTransformation = new float[MathsUtils.MATRIX_4X4]; in RingRenderable() 63 MathsUtils.setLookAtM(rotationTransformation, in RingRenderable() 71 float[] translationTransformation = new float[MathsUtils.MATRIX_4X4]; in RingRenderable()
|
D | Light.java | 18 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 19 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 20 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z;
|
D | RectangleRenderable.java | 18 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 19 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 20 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z;
|
D | CameraPreviewRenderable.java | 18 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 19 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 20 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z;
|
D | ConeRenderable.java | 18 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 19 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 20 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z;
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/sixdof/Utils/Path/ |
D | RobustnessPath.java | 19 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 158 MathsUtils.normalizeVector(values); in calculateRotation() 162 Matrix.multiplyMV(adjustedXAxis, 0, MathsUtils.getDeviceOrientationMatrix(mOpenGlRotation), in calculateRotation() 166 … double angle = Math.acos(MathsUtils.dotProduct(values, adjustedXAxis, MathsUtils.VECTOR_3D)); in calculateRotation() 169 angle = Math.toDegrees(angle) - MathsUtils.ORIENTATION_90_ANTI_CLOCKWISE; in calculateRotation() 209 mDistanceOfPathFailedRotation += MathsUtils.distanceCalculationOnXYPlane( in testRotation() 227 if (MathsUtils.distanceCalculationInXYZSpace(marker.getCoordinates(), in checkIfRotationTestable()
|
D | ReferencePath.java | 20 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 79 distance = MathsUtils.distanceCalculationOnXYPlane( in calculatePathRemaining() 118 if (MathsUtils.distanceCalculationInXYZSpace(waypoint.getCoordinates(), in validateWaypointDistance() 159 float distance = MathsUtils.distanceCalculationInXYZSpace( in validateBackToStart()
|
D | ComplexMovementPath.java | 21 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.VECTOR_2D; 22 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.X; 23 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Y; 24 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.Z; 25 import static com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ils.dotProduct; 27 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 210 pathRemaining += MathsUtils.distanceCalculationOnXYPlane( in calculateRingLocationOnPath()
|
D | Path.java | 19 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 65 float distance = MathsUtils.distanceCalculationOnXYPlane( in getLengthOfCurrentPath()
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/sixdof/Utils/TestPhase/ |
D | Test.java | 21 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 132 distance = MathsUtils.distanceCalculationInXYZSpace( in markerTest() 163 String referenceMarker = MathsUtils.coordinatesToString( in recordMarkerTestResults() 165 String testMarker = MathsUtils.coordinatesToString( in recordMarkerTestResults() 202 distance = MathsUtils.distanceCalculationOnXYPlane( in calculatePathDistance()
|
D | RobustnessTest.java | 22 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 120 String markerToPlace = MathsUtils.coordinatesToString( in recordTimerTestResults()
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/sixdof/Utils/ |
D | Manager.java | 132 MathsUtils.coordinatesToString(initialCoords); in addPoseDataToPath() 134 MathsUtils.distanceCalculationInXYZSpace( in addPoseDataToPath() 142 + MathsUtils.coordinatesToString(coordinates); in addPoseDataToPath()
|
D | MathsUtils.java | 28 public class MathsUtils { class
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/sixdof/Fragments/ |
D | AccuracyFragment.java | 26 import com.android.cts.verifier.sensors.sixdof.Utils.MathsUtils; 177 … MathsUtils.coordinatesToString(waypoint.getCoordinates()) + "\n"; in setupUILoop()
|